    Quote Originally Posted by JohnnyHockey13 View Post
    This quote is hidden because you are ignoring this member. Show Quote
    ZA bank account, then TransferWise.com is what I was told.
    Yea, that's the easiest way. Got mine done.

    What you need is your HKID and a HK phone number that can receive SMS. Download the ZA Bank app, and have someone buy a SIM card in HK and stay on the phone with them while you setup your account (it needs the code within 60 seconds to activate the account). Once the account is activated, it does a HKID scan to get all the information, validate it's a real card, then it'll scan your face to make sure it's you. Account is up and running at that point. Setup an email, verify the email, and further correspondence is then through email and can toss the SIM. Once all that is done, scroll through to the Cash Payout Scheme banner, one click, register, and a week or 2 later you have $10k in your account.

    After that, transfer it all to a friend's account, and have them wire you the money. It's all in English too. Super easy.
